In quantity surveying, there are several types of bills, including the Bill of Quantities (BoQ), which itemizes the materials, labor, and costs for construction projects; the Schedule of Rates, which provides a list of unit rates for various tasks; and the Cost Plan, which outlines estimated costs for a project, often used for budgeting purposes. Each type serves a specific purpose in project management, cost estimation, and financial control throughout the construction process.
In quantity surveying, a financial statement is a detailed report that outlines the costs associated with a construction project. It typically includes estimates, budgets, and actual expenditures, allowing for effective financial management and decision-making throughout the project lifecycle. These statements help ensure that the project stays within budget and provides transparency for stakeholders regarding financial performance. Ultimately, they serve as a critical tool for tracking and controlling project costs.

In quantity surveying it means extracting all the measured items in a drawing so as to create a "bill of materials". For example, if building a home you need to know the quantity of all the materials required, so you 'take off' and list all the lumber, drywall, piping, fittings, tiles, etc., etc.

A data book is a ready reckoner of formulae of geometrical properties of various shapes used in quantity surveying. It also gives equations used in the calculation of quantities such as Simpson's rule for calculation of earthwork.
